Synopsis "You're not the Only one "

Do not be conformed to this world, but be transformed by the renewal of your mind, that by testing you may discern what is the will of God, what is good and acceptable and perfect. - Romans 12:2 (esv) Emotions - we've all got them. Whether or not we like to admit it, we all have a twinge of jealousy now and then or experience loneliness or let our anger get the best of us. The important thing to realize is you are not the only one who feels these things. Tami Coble Brown offers insights into how God's Word and our sisters in Christ can help us through the rough times. Don't let your emotional bad habits get the best of you. To paraphrase Proverbs 27:17: As iron sharpens iron, so a woman sharpens the countenance of her friend. Tami Coble Brown, a graduate of Lipscomb University, spent two years as a missionary apprentice in Northern Ireland, where she met and eventually married an Irish-born preacher, Maurice Brown. They have served churches of Christ in Scotland, Virginia and Canada, and currently work with Broadway Church of Christ in Rockford, Ill. They have three grown sons, Stephen, Andrew and Tim.
